EVENT: XVIII BRSI Convention & International Conference BRE3CH2021

0
By Biotech Express on December 17, 2021 BioEvents

The XVIII BRSI convention and the International Conference on Biotechnology for Resource Efficiency, Energy, Environment, Chemicals, and Health (BRE3CH2021) was jointly organized by the CSIR-Indian Institute of Petroleum, Dehradun, Uttarakhand, India and the Biotech Research Society, India (BRSI) in association with the International Bioprocessing Association, France; the Centre for Energy and Environmental Sustainability (CEES)-India; CDC Jaipur and International Solid Waste Association (India chapter). The event was hosted by CSIR-IIP, Dehradun. Dr. Anjan Ray, Director, CSIR-IIP, Dehradun was the Patron of the event. Prof Sudhir Sopory, President of the BRSI was the conference chair, and Professor Ashok Pandey, Distinguished Scientist, CSIR-IITR was the conference General Chair and Prof Huu Hao Ngo, University of Technology Sydney, Australia; Prof Claude Gilles Dussap, Universite Clermont Auvergne, France and Prof Samir Khanal, University of Hawaii, USA were the conference international chairs. Professor Sunil K Khare of IIT Delhi, and Dr. Vivek Agrawal, CMD, CDC Jaipur were the conference Co-chairs. Dr. Thallada Bhaskar of CSIR-IIP was the Chairman of, Local Organizing Committee. Dr. Debashish Ghosh, CSIR-IIP was the convenor of the conference. Dr. Binod Parameswaran, CoE, BRSI, and Pr. Sc. CSIR-NIIST, Dr. Vivekanand, MNIT Jaipur, Dr. Bhavya B Krishna, Sr. Sc., CSIR-IIP, and Professor Kamlesh Chaure, AKS University, Satna were the co-convenors of the conference.

The conference was actively supported by NIT, Srinagar, Uttarakhand; ICWM (Indian Chapter); AKS University, Satna; AFSTI. Biotech Express was the media partner. Several academic journals, namely, Bioresource Technology, Bioresource Technology Reports, Systems Microbiology & Biomanufacturing, Bioenergy Research, Journal of Food Science and Technology, Indian Journal of Experimental Biology and Journal of Energy and Energy and Environmental Sustainability will bring out special issues based on the presentations made in the conference.

BRE3CH2021 was conceptualized to provide a platform to bring the stakeholders, including the researchers, policy planners, and industry personnel to discuss and share the thoughts for future projects by collaboration in the area of bioenergy/biofuels/biotechnology & microbiology, etc. This International conference focused on recent developments in the frontier areas of biotechnology/biofuels/biochemicals and brought together scientists, engineers, and other experts from across the world to deliberate on global developments in the field of biotechnology, covering industrial, agricultural, environmental, interdisciplinary biotechnology. The theme of the conference was divided into seven subthemes, and all deliberations were categorized under them.

The conference was opened on 1st December 2021 at 1630 h IST in Dr BR Ambedkar International Training Center at CSIR-IIP, and Drs. Thallada Bhaskar and Debashish Ghosh gave a glimpse of the technical details and organization of the conference in their opening remarks. In this conference, there were 12 plenary talks, 104 invited talks, 10 short orals, and 269 flash talks and posters, which were deliberated in four parallel sessions from 2nd to 4th December 2021. Prof. Sudhir K Sopory, the president of BRSI welcomed all the delegates, which included about 300 participating virtually from 33 countries and about 100 from India attending physically. Dr. Anjan Ray, Director, CSIR-IIP and Professor Huu Hao Ngo, the conference international chair & President IBA welcomed the delegates. The guest of Honour, Professor Tej Pal Singh inspired the gathering through his motivating talk. Afterward, Professor Ashok Pandey, Distinguished Scientist, CSIR-IITR, and conference General Chair addressed the gathering. This was followed by the electronic release of the BRSI Year Book and BRE3CH2021 Abstract book.

The star attraction of the opening session was the BRSI awards function, in which the names of the winners of the annual awards of BRSI for the year 2020-2021 were announced and were felicitated. After the awards function, there were three lectures by the awardees. The first talk was by Dr. Saurabh Saran, Pr. Sc., CSIR-IIIM, Jammu (Industrial Medal Award Winner). The second lecture was given by Woman Scientist Award Winner, Prof. Shilpi Sharma, IIT Delhi; and the third lecture was given by Dr. Akansha Singh, of CSIR-CIMAP (Young Scientist Award Winner).

In the following two and half days, in four parallel sessions, the delegates witnessed 30 minutes plenary lectures (12 talks), 104 Invited talks (20 minutes each), 104 short orals (10 minutes each), and 269 flash talk and posters (4 minutes each).

The on-site and virtual management of the scientific program of the conference was moderated by Drs. Bhavya B Krishna, and Vinod Kumar (Hall A); Sunita Virjani, and Sindhu R (Hall B); Vivekanand, and Dharmendra Tripathi (Hall C); Kamlesh Choure, and Archana Tiwari (Hall D). The poster sessions were moderated by Drs. Rakesh K Mishra, Vikash Kaushal, and Arvind Madhavan.

During BRE3CH2021, there was no physical presentation of posters. All presenters submitted their e-posters on the BRE3CH2021 website (Authors’ self-dashboard in the BRE3CH2021 portal). The posters were evaluated online; all the poster presenters also presented their work under Rapid presentations (5-slides in 3-minutes and 1 minute Q&A). All the short orals and Rapid presentations & posters were evaluated by the juries for selecting BEST PAPERS under different scientific themes to give awards as BEST ORAL PRESENTATION and BEST RAPID PRESENTATION & POSTER (RPP), which were sponsored by the (i) Khanal Foundation (a certificate and cash of Rs 2500 to each winner), (ii) Centre for Energy and Environmental Sustainability- India, comprising a certificate and a book published by Elsevier, (iii) Taylor & Francis (a certificate and a book published by T&F) and BRSI (a certificate).

The closing/valedictory session was held on 4th December 2021 at 1315 h IST in which Best Paper Awards were conferred. Also, the venue for the XIX Convention of the BRSI was announced by Prof Sunil Khare, Vice-President of BRSI which was Indian Institute of Technology, Guwahati, Assam, India to be held on December 7-11 December 2022. Professor Latha Rangan will be the convenor of the event and Professor Kaustubha Mohanty co-convener.

The BRE3CH2021 was organized under the hybrid mode, following full safety and precautions protocols
